Food Lion, Inc. v. Newsome

Citations

  • 515 S.E.2d 317
  • 30 Va. App. 21
  • 1999 Va. App. LEXIS 320

How courts have described this case

Verbatim parenthetical descriptions written by other courts when citing this decision. Ranked by citation-network relevance.

  • employee not terminated for misconduct is entitled to cure constructive refusal
  • “[BJeeause Newsome properly cured his refusal of selective employment, as long as he fully markets his residual capacity, we find no authority to limit the employer’s liability to the difference between Newsome’s refused selective employment wage and his pre-injury wage.”
  • “[B]ecause Newsome properly cured his refusal of selective employment, as long as he fully markets his residual capacity, we find no authority to limit the employer’s liability to the difference between Newsome’s refused selective employment wage and his pre-injury wage.”
